Output 528d6bb077403e1a00cfff879edd1ba1af3f055e711786353d7d1b76ec87fec3:1

value
66340246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e93d19e21fca9386265dd0376109b7085e8149 OP_EQUAL
address
MCivn7VNEPSJ82MJ2T4LAV4kDGNugMPzqH
transaction
528d6bb077403e1a00cfff879edd1ba1af3f055e711786353d7d1b76ec87fec3
spent
true